搭建一个网站是一个涉及多个步骤的过程,从选择服务器到配置环境,再到部署网站,每一步都需要细心操作,以下是详细的搭建过程:
准备工作
1、选购服务器:可以选择云服务提供商如AWS、阿里云等,或者自己购买一台物理服务器。
2、选择操作系统:常见的有Linux和Windows,根据个人喜好和熟悉程度选择。
3、注册域名:选择一个合适的域名并进行注册,这是网站的地址。
4、准备建站工具:可以选择免费的建站工具如Apache或Nginx。
服务器配置
1、更改服务器密码:登录服务器后,立即更改默认密码以提高安全性。
2、设置安全组和端口开放:根据需要开放相应的端口,如80端口用于HTTP服务,443端口用于HTTPS服务。
3、远程连接:使用XShell等工具进行远程连接,方便管理服务器。
4、安装宝塔面板:宝塔面板可以简化服务器管理和网站搭建过程。
网站部署
1、安装Web服务器:根据选择的建站工具,安装Nginx或Apache。
2、配置数据库:安装MySQL或其他数据库,并创建数据库和用户。
3、上传网站文件:将网站文件上传到服务器指定目录。
4、绑定域名:在服务器上配置DNS解析,将域名指向服务器IP。
5、测试网站:通过浏览器访问域名,检查网站是否正常工作。
相关问题与解答
1、如何选择合适的服务器?
性能需求:根据网站的预期流量和资源需求选择合适的服务器规格。
成本预算:考虑长期运营成本,包括服务器租用费用和维护费用。
服务商信誉:选择信誉良好的服务商,确保服务器稳定性和服务质量。
2、如何在不购买服务器的情况下搭建网站?
使用免费建站工具:利用如WordPress.com、Wix等提供的免费建站服务。
利用学生优惠:部分云服务提供商为学生提供免费或优惠的服务器资源。
共享主机服务:选择低成本的共享主机服务,与他人共享服务器资源。
搭建网站是一个系统工程,需要从服务器选择、配置到网站部署等多个方面综合考虑,通过上述步骤,即使是初学者也能逐步建立起自己的网站,在实际操作过程中,可能会遇到各种问题,但只要耐心解决,就能够成功搭建起属于自己的网站。
到此,以上就是小编对于“服务器如何搭建网站教程”的问题就介绍到这了,希望介绍的几点解答对大家有用,有任何问题和不懂的,欢迎各位朋友在评论区讨论,给我留言。